    C1 (1960) Radiator Drain Hose - Where can I get one?

    The TIM and JG describes the rubber hose that attaches to the petcock as having three ribs. I found these listed in Dr. Rebuild's catalog but he has a minimum $20 order size. Has anyone found something acceptable at a auto parts store?
